Charlotte's designs on colourful future

A Preston student is made up after reaching the finals of a prestigious national competition.

Charlotte Martin, a level three theatrical and media make-up student at Preston’s College, is heading to London to compete in the jane iredale National Student Makeup Competition.

The three day event is taking place from now until Wednesday and will see Charlotte where Charlotte e joined by five other front-runners and receive bespoke advanced training for two days before recreating her interpretation of this year’s theme, Animals on Earth and Beyond.

The winning student will receive make-up worth £1,000 to kick start their career, and the winning college will receive £1,000 of jane iredale® mineral cosmetic products for student training.

Lisa Anderson, theatrical and media make-up tutor at the Fulwood college, said: “It’s a brilliant achievement for

Charlotte as she was up against more than 200 students from 100 colleges across the UK. Charlotte’s make-up is always immaculate but her entry has really taken the judges by storm.

“It was her idea and I’ve been around to help her bring it to life.

“She’s quite stunned about her success and excited about opportunities such competitions provide.”

Other students from Charlotte’s course came up with ideas and created entries but only those over 18 were able to submit.

Charlotte added: “I only found out about reaching the final a couple of days ago and I am still in shock. It’s my first ever competition and as much as I look forward to it, I’m also really nervous. But I know it will be an amazing experience and look great on my CV.”

She hopes to pursue a career as a freelance make-up artist and do a level four media make-up course which the college hopes to introduce in September.
